如何利用Linux iptables规则阻止特定IP地址访问?

要在Linux中使用iptables禁止某些IP访问,首先需要确定要禁止的IP地址,然后使用iptables命令将这些IP添加到黑名单中。具体操作如下:,,1. 打开终端。,2. 输入以下命令,将IP地址(例如192.168.1.1)添加到黑名单中:,,“bash,sudo iptables A INPUT s 192.168.1.1 j DROP,`,,3. 保存更改并退出:,,`bash,sudo iptablessave,“,,这样,指定的IP地址将被禁止访问您的Linux系统。

在 Linux 系统中,我们可以使用iptables 工具来配置防火墙规则,从而禁止某些 IP 地址访问我们的系统,下面是一些步骤和示例代码,演示如何使用iptables 来实现这个目标。

Linux 使用 iptables 禁止某些 IP 访问
(图片来源网络,侵删)

步骤1:查看当前的防火墙规则

我们需要查看当前的防火墙规则,以确保我们不会无意中覆盖或修改任何重要的规则,可以使用以下命令查看当前的防火墙规则:

sudo iptables L

步骤2:添加新的防火墙规则

我们将添加一个新的规则来禁止特定的 IP 地址访问我们的系统,假设我们要禁止 IP 地址为192.168.1.100 的主机访问我们的系统,我们可以使用以下命令:

sudo iptables A INPUT s 192.168.1.100 j DROP

这条命令的含义是:将源 IP 地址为192.168.1.100 的所有输入流量丢弃(即拒绝访问)。

Linux 使用 iptables 禁止某些 IP 访问
(图片来源网络,侵删)

步骤3:保存防火墙规则

为了使这些规则在系统重启后仍然生效,我们需要将这些规则保存到持久化存储中,这可以通过安装iptablespersistent 软件包来实现,在 Debian/Ubuntu 系统中,可以使用以下命令安装:

sudo aptget install iptablespersistent

安装完成后,可以使用以下命令保存当前的防火墙规则:

sudo netfilterpersistent save

步骤4:验证规则是否生效

我们需要验证新添加的规则是否生效,可以尝试从被禁止的 IP 地址访问系统,看是否能够成功连接,如果无法连接,说明规则已经生效。

Linux 使用 iptables 禁止某些 IP 访问
(图片来源网络,侵删)

相关问题与解答

问题1:如何删除已添加的防火墙规则?

答案:要删除之前添加的防火墙规则,可以使用iptables 命令的D 选项,后面跟上链名、规则序号和匹配条件,要删除之前添加的规则,可以执行以下命令:

sudo iptables D INPUT s 192.168.1.100 j DROP

然后再次运行sudo iptables L 命令,确认规则已被删除。

问题2:如何允许特定 IP 地址访问系统?

答案:要允许特定 IP 地址访问系统,可以使用iptables 命令的A 选项,并将j 参数设置为ACCEPT,要允许 IP 地址为192.168.1.100 的主机访问系统,可以执行以下命令:

sudo iptables A INPUT s 192.168.1.100 j ACCEPT

这将允许来自该 IP 地址的所有输入流量通过防火墙,同样地,可以使用sudo iptables L 命令查看更新后的防火墙规则。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/985455.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-09-04 03:25
下一篇 2024-09-04 03:25

相关推荐

  • 如何有效防止网络数据泄露?

    防止网络数据泄露在当今数字化时代,数据已成为企业和个人最宝贵的资产之一,随着网络攻击手段的不断升级和复杂化,数据泄露事件频发,给企业和个人带来了巨大的损失,加强网络数据保护,防止数据泄露成为当务之急,本文将从多个方面探讨如何有效防止网络数据泄露,了解数据泄露的风险与后果1、风险:数据泄露可能导致敏感信息被窃取……

    2024-11-06
    01
  • 防火墙出现异常,我该如何处理?

    防火墙作为网络安全的重要组成部分,其主要功能是监控和控制进出网络的流量,以防止未经授权的访问,防火墙在运行过程中可能会出现异常情况,导致网络连接中断或无法正常访问特定站点,以下是一些关于防火墙出现异常怎么办的建议:1、检查网络连接:确认你的设备是否处于良好的网络环境中,并检查是否连接了正确的Wi-Fi或移动数据……

    2024-11-06
    06
  • 防火墙WAF是什么?解析网络安全中的关键术语

    防火墙WAF(Web应用防火墙)概述一、什么是WAF?WAF,全称为Web应用防火墙(Web Application Firewall),是一种专门设计用于保护Web应用程序的安全设备或服务,它通过过滤和监视Web应用程序与Internet之间的HTTP通信来帮助识别、监控和阻止恶意流量,从而保护Web应用程序……

    2024-11-06
    017
  • 什么是防火墙云网络版?它有哪些独特功能和优势?

    防火墙云网络版一、概述1 什么是云防火墙?云防火墙(Cloud Firewall,CFW)是一种基于公有云环境下的SaaS化防火墙,主要为用户提供互联网边界的防护,它不仅具备传统防火墙的功能,还支持云上多租户和弹性扩容功能,是用户业务上云的第一个网络安全基础设施,2 云防火墙的主要功能云防火墙提供以下主要功能……

    2024-11-05
    012

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入